Section 1-18-2 - Purpose and duties of office.

1-18-2. Purpose and duties of office. The Office of History within the Department of Tourism and State Development shall collect, preserve, exhibit, and publish material for the study of history, especially the history of this and adjacent states. To this end, the office shall explore the archaeology of the region; acquire documents and manuscripts; obtain narratives and records of pioneers; conduct a library of historical reference; maintain a gallery of historical portraiture, and an ethnological and historical museum; publish and otherwise diffuse information relating to the history of the region to schools and communities; and in general encourage and develop within the state the study of history.

Source: SDC 1939, § 29.0102; SL 1996, ch 8, § 1; SL 2003, ch 272 (Ex. Ord. 03-1), § 79.
